Expert Opinion

Based on the provided information, it appears that the caller with the phone number +18882287783 is likely involved in a phishing scam, where they try to trick people into revealing sensitive information. Many users reported receiving emails with grammar and spelling mistakes, which is a common trait of scam emails. The emails claimed to be from Equifax, but the phone number provided did not match the one listed on the official Equifax website, raising suspicion. Some users even reported losing money after interacting with the scammers. It's essential to be cautious when receiving unsolicited emails or calls, especially during tax season when such scams are more common.
